Exchange | several times a day to get more restore points

Post by ocico »

hi guys,

my customer wants to backup his EXO mailboxes several time a day. Does someone has experience with that?
I thought that its not just a critical request, because of every job is a incremental job (except the first one).

Can I control that in my proxy configuration, by adjusting the number of threads (default is 64), or by adjusting the network bandwidth?

What do you think about this?
Thank you.

Re: Exchange | several times a day to get more restore points

Post by Mike Resseler » 1 person likes this post

Backing up the mailbox several times a day is simple. You create a job and adjust the policy. You are indeed right that those are incremental so it should not be a big issue. However, most likely the total size will be a bit bigger as more "changes" will be caught, depending on what the EXO does with his mailbox.

No need to play with the number of threads or network bandwidth adjustments.
